New iMac, new video card, problems using full gamit of CRT

The Vision Science Lab at UChicago (PI Steve Shevell) recently upgraded the iMacs. The new iMacs have a different video card than the older iMacs, and we find that the output of the video card to a CRT is inconsistent, with much lower luminance output than the older iMac.

This doesn't appear to be a problem specific to PsychToolBox, as we've also run color calibration software in XCode with the same result.

Details:
Psychtoolbox version: 3.0.14
OS 10.12.5
Video card: Intel Iris Pro Graphics 6200 1536MB

OLD iMac version (that we used for years and never had issues with calibration/displaying color)
OS 10.8.5
Video card: GeForce GT 640M 512MB

In particular, the old iMac still outputs good luminance values for each gun on the CRT (R = 6, G = 18, B = 3.5), but the new iMac reduces the maximum luminance to R = 4.8, G = 12, B = 1.5.
